March 10, 2001
Men's Tennis Nips Furman 4-3
Wake Forest picks up home victory against Paladins
WINSTON-SALEM, NC - The 32nd ranked Wake Forest men's tennis team
defeated Furman, 4-3 Saturday morning at Leighton Stadium. Wake Forest
split the singles matches 3-3 with the Paladins, but the Demon Deacons
captured the doubles point to earn the victory.
Raul Munoz and doubles partner David Loewenthal beat Furman's John
Chesworth and James Cameron 8-6 in the number one doubles match while
Wake Forest's Mike Murray teamed up with David Bere to defeat Andrew
Rogers and Patrick Fillnow of Furman 8-4 in the number two doubles
match. The Paladin's duo of Charlie Loyd and Chris Henderson topped
Justin Kaufmann and Andrew Simpson of the Demon Deacons 8-5.
In singles play, David Bere picked up a win for the Old Gold and Black
in the number one match over Lee Nickell, 7-5, 6-1. Wake Forest also
claimed the number two match when Raul Munoz defeated Furman's John
Chesworth 6-1, 6-1. The Paladins won three through five as James Cameron
battled past Demon Deacon David Loewenthal 6-3, 7-6 (6), Patrick Gaughan
took down Wake Forest's Mike Murray 7-5, 6-0 and Patrick Fillnow edged
the Deac's number five player, Justin Kaufmann, 6-2, 5-7, 6-4. Trent
Brendon sealed the victory for the Deacons when he dropped Eric Ward
6-2, 6-3 in the number six singles match.
Furman falls to 6-5 on the season while Wake Forest improves to 6-2 on
the year. The Demon Deacons will return to action Monday, March 12, when
they open ACC play by hosting No. 47 Florida State at 1:00 p.m. in
Leighton Stadium.
